After experiencing the exact same as Jozsi did, where the motor was stiff in one direction and sluggish in the other I replaced U9 since that fixed Jozsi's drive up. However, mine is still behaving strange.
Background:
Replaced C28 with 4.7uF/25V tantalum cap.
Replaced R54 with jumper wire
Placed 1N4148 between R54 and GND, cathode facing GND
Replaced R21 with 4.7k resistor.
Ref1 voltage measures to 2.96V, Vref set to 80mV, VrefOC measures to 180mV.
1) 60V powersupply, everything seems normal, motor feels and sounds the same in both direction - slow limit LED does not come on, no matter what though.
2) 90V powersupply, motor stiff in one direction sluggish in the other, slow limit LED never comes on. Vpp across sense resistor seems to match VrefOC when turning the shaft one directiona and Vref when the turning the shaft in the other direction - VERY noicy though.
3) 120V powersupply, motor stiff in one direction sluggish in the other, slow limit LED never comes on. Measurements as with 90V supply.
4) Backing off the powersupply voltage to around 60V and it's back to "normal" again. That is peak-current all the time.
I've desoldered and checked the Schotky diode and I've replaced U9 a second time but the results are exactly the same.
